首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何避免Userform Combobox运行时错误?

避免Userform Combobox运行时错误的方法有以下几种:

  1. 检查数据源:确保你为Combobox提供了正确的数据源。在绑定Combobox之前,应该先验证数据源是否包含所需的数据,并且数据格式正确。同时,应该避免在Combobox数据源中引入无效或重复的数据项,以防止出现运行时错误。
  2. 错误处理:在代码中使用错误处理机制来捕获并处理可能出现的运行时错误。可以使用VBA的Try-Catch语句或On Error语句来捕获运行时错误,并采取适当的措施,如显示错误消息、恢复到默认状态或终止程序的执行。
  3. 输入验证:在用户输入数据之前,进行适当的输入验证以确保数据的正确性。可以使用正则表达式或其他验证方法来验证用户输入,并在用户输入无效数据时提供适当的错误提示。
  4. 锁定Combobox:如果需要,可以在加载Userform时将Combobox设置为只读或禁用状态,以防止用户进行不正确的操作。这样可以有效地避免用户输入错误数据或引发运行时错误。
  5. 更新软件版本:确保使用的VBA和Excel版本是最新的,并且已安装了所有相关的更新和修补程序。有时,运行时错误可能是由于软件本身的错误或不完善之处引起的,更新到最新版本可以解决某些问题。

请注意,以上方法是一般性的建议,具体的解决方法可能因用户实际情况和代码实现而有所不同。此外,推荐的腾讯云相关产品和产品介绍链接地址无法提供,因为在要求中明确要求不提及具体的云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券